Question

elements that do not have complete sets of valence electrons tend to *
1 point
be simpler.
be smaller.
react.
change from metals to nonmetals.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Elements with incomplete valence electron sets aim to achieve a stable electron configuration (like a noble gas configuration). This drives them to react (e.g., form bonds, gain/lose electrons) to complete their valence shells. "Be simpler" and "be smaller" are not related to valence electron completeness. Changing from metals to nonmetals also doesn't relate to this concept. So the correct choice is the one about reacting.

Answer:

C. react.
